Behavioral Health Professional (BHP) Certification Training

with Woodfords Family Services

$25 More Info

Our communities are looking for individuals who want to make a difference in a child’s life.

Children’s behavioral health services are vital to Maine’s children with intellectual disabilities, autism, and mental health disorders and their families. And the need in our area is great! As an integral part of the child’s treatment team, a Certified Behavioral Health Professional (BHP) has the opportunity to make an immediate impact while helping a child grow and develop to their full potential.

We are excited to connect our communities with Woodfords Family Services for this wonderful online training program. The online training will equip you to successfully help children who are currently on a waitlist for services. The training will prepare you for employment through local social services agencies. The program can be started at any time and finished at your own pace.

  • You will complete 12 online modules then two 4-hour live sessions. 
  • Once the modules are completed, you will receive free online bloodborne pathogen training and virtual First Aid & CPR training if you do not already possess those certifications. 
  • The entire training requirements will take about 45 hours.
  • Assistance with job placement is provided to anyone who completes the program.
  • Assistance with technology may be available.

 Prerequisites:

  • A high school diploma or equivalency. Proof of education is required.
  • Must be 18 years of age or older upon completion of the course.
  • An administration fee of $25 is required at registration.
  • A reading comprehension assessment is required prior to completing the application, administered through your local Maine Adult Education program. This requirement may be waived by showing successful completion of a college-level English course.
